The Good Old Days Antiques
We heart the friendly — and informative — employees at this cavernous shop. And,
the prices aren’t bad considering the tags are attached to items like electronically
restored radios and gorgeous chandeliers. If you’ve got a little time to kill, sort
through the eclectic array of tchotchkes (killer wine glasses, anyone?) on the tightly
packed shelves.
The Good Old Days Antiques, 2138 West Belmont Avenue (between Leavitt Street
and Hoyne Avenue); 773-472-8837.
